Organizacja pozarządowa Wielka Brytania

Usprawnienie wydajności systemu i funkcji raportowania

Podsumowanie

Wyzwanie: Organizacja Freedom from Torture postanowiła zająć się ograniczeniami systemu Daylight, który służy jej do zarządzania danymi użytkowników i wewnętrznymi procesami. Klientowi zależało na tym, by określić możliwości systemu, zwiększyć jego wydajność i stabilność oraz usprawnić zarządzanie danymi. Ulepszenia systemu miały spełniać potrzeby organizacji, a jednocześnie mieścić się w budżecie.

Podejście: Przeprowadziliśmy złożone warsztaty projektowe, w których wzięli udział kluczowi interesariusze. Dzięki temu udało się precyzyjnie określić wymagania klienta. Dodatkowo zrealizowaliśmy kilka audytów technologicznych architektury i bezpieczeństwa systemu, a także samych danych. Następnie zaproponowaliśmy podzieloną na etapy strategię działania, która odnosiła się do zarówno bieżących, jak i długofalowych potrzeb.

Rezultat: W ramach naszej współpracy klient otrzymał propozycję rozłożonej na etapy strategii ulepszenia systemu. Na jej podstawie może podejmować przemyślane decyzje dotyczące dalszych inwestycji oraz poprawić ogólną jakość usług. Zaplanowane zmiany to usprawnienie procesu raportowania i organizacji pracy oraz polepszenie jakości UX i stabilności systemu.

Spis treści

O kliencie

Freedom from Torture to brytyjska organizacja charytatywna pomagająca osobom, które przeżyły torturowanie. Organizacja oferuje specjalistyczne wsparcie w postaci psychoterapii, doradztwa prawnego i opieki socjalnej – dla wielu osób okazuje się ostatnią deską ratunku. Organizacja powstała w 1985 roku i działa w 5 lokalizacjach w Wielkiej Brytanii: w Londynie, Manchesterze, Birmingham, Glasgow i Newcastle.

Freedom from Torture w kompleksowy sposób dba o to, by ofiary tortur otrzymywały potrzebną pomoc i mogły odbudować swoje życie.

Wyzwanie biznesowe

Organizacja Freedom from Torture mierzyła się z licznymi problemami związanymi z systemem Daylight, które nie był w pełni dostosowany do realizowanych przez nią nietypowych procesów. Raportowanie wymagało użycia plików Excel poza systemem, co mogło skutkować rozproszeniem informacji i utrudniało szybką analizę sytuacji odbiorców. Ponadto integracja wykorzystywanego systemu z innymi narzędziami Microsoft także wymagała poprawy. Aby ostatecznie zwiększyć efektywność działania organizacji, należało także zająć się doświadczeniem użytkownika.

Jako że Freedom from Torture to organizacja non-profit, do modernizacji systemu potrzebne było ekonomiczne rozwiązanie. Przed podjęciem jakiejkolwiek decyzji klient chciał dowiedzieć się dokładnie, jakie zmiany są konieczne oraz jakie koszty są z nimi związane. Rozwiązanie miało być jednocześnie skuteczne i budżetowe.

Wybór naszej firmy był strategicznym posunięciem – oferujemy wyjątkowe, multidyscyplinarne podejście, w którym łączymy wiedzę i doświadczenie w zakresie bezpieczeństwa i architektury danych. Dzięki temu zapewniamy holistyczne i bezproblemowe realizacje, które idealnie odpowiadają na potrzeby klienta i przynoszą solidne, zintegrowane rozwiązania.

Zakres prac

By rozwiązać problem klienta, wdrożyliśmy rozległą strategię podzieloną na kilka etapów. Zakres naszych prac obejmował warsztaty projektowe, audyty technologiczne, utworzenie planu kolejnych etapów realizacji ulepszeń oraz oszacowanie możliwych kosztów realizacji. Nasz zespół zadbał o to, by każde zalecenie było spójne z misją organizacji i jej celami operacyjnymi. Połączyliśmy ze sobą ekspertów z różnych dziedzin i skupiliśmy się na ścisłej współpracy i tworzeniu dopasowanego do klienta rozwiązania.

Kluczowe etapy i efekty projektu

Warsztaty projektowe

Warsztaty trwały 4 dni i dotyczyły potrzeb użytkowników, procesów w organizacji oraz wymagań funkcjonalnych (backlog) i niefunkcjonalnych. Spotkania te pozwoliły nam uzyskać szczegółowe informacje od ponad 30 zaangażowanych osób, dzięki czemu mogliśmy zmapować bieżące procesy i problemy, co stało się fundamentem dla zaproponowanych rozwiązań.

Raport podsumowujący warsztaty

Raport zawierał wszystkie informacje zgromadzone w ramach warsztatów, skompilowane w jednym obszernym dokumencie. Były to podsumowania wniosków z warsztatów, nasze rekomendacje, wymagania niefunkcjonalne, wymagania dotyczące raportowania oraz zaawansowany backlog rozwiązania. Informacje te dały Freedom from Torture jasny obraz sytuacji, aktualnego stanu systemu i dalszych potrzeb.

Audyt technologiczny

Przeprowadziliśmy dogłębny audyt technologiczny, by ocenić części systemu Daylight związane z architekturą i bezpieczeństwem danych oraz zarządzaniem nimi. Audyt stał się podstawą dla dalszych propozycji usprawnień, dzięki którym system skutecznie pomaga Freedom from Torture w nawigowaniu specyficznymi procesami.

Ocena potrzebnych zasobów

Zaproponowaliśmy rozwiązanie podzielone na etapy, w ramach których zaplanowaliśmy wdrożenie priorytetowych funkcjonalności i ulepszeń oraz przedstawiliśmy szacunkowy harmonogram i kosztorys.

Zaproponowane rozwiązania

Plan aktualizacji systemu

Nasz plan aktualizacji systemu Daylight składał się z dwóch etapów. W pierwszej fazie system pozostawał oprogramowaniem lokalnym, a nowe funkcje miały być wdrażane w jego obrębie lub przy użyciu rozwiązań chmurowych, takich jak Power BI oraz platformy low-code i no-code. W drugiej fazie system miał zostać zmigrowany do chmury, by wykorzystać jej zalety, takie jak skalowalność, wysoka dostępność i zdalne zarządzanie – wszystko to w zgodzie z obowiązującymi przepisami. Plan uwzględniał dostosowanie realizacji do konkretnych potrzeb i procesów Freedom from Torture. Dzięki takiemu zintegrowanemu podejściu aktualizacja systemu została przeprowadzona bezbłędnie, a wszystkie funkcje – od bezpieczeństwa po zarządzanie danymi – działają w optymalny sposób.

Ulepszenia dotyczące zarządzania danymi

W celu zwiększenia wydajności i poziomu bezpieczeństwa zasugerowaliśmy, by odłączyć dokumentację klienta od bazy danych MS SQL Daylight, a w zamian za to wprowadzić scentralizowany system zarządzania danymi. Taka metoda zabezpiecza dane użytkowników iułatwia dostęp do nich na każdym etapie kontaktu z Freedom from Torture. 

Zwiększenie bezpieczeństwa

Najważniejsze usprawnienia dotyczące bezpieczeństwa to wdrożenie monitorowania systemu i alertów, przyjęcie dobrych praktyk SecDevOps w celu stałej kontroli bezpieczeństwa oraz integracja z zewnętrznym systemem SSO dla zapewnienia lepszego uwierzytelniania.

Usprawnienie wydajności procesów

Aby usprawnić wydajność procesów i monitorowania działań w organizacji, zaproponowaliśmy liczne ulepszenia, w tym centralizację informacji, wdrożenie systemu rezerwacji spotkań, zwiększenie czytelności notatek użytkowników, integrację dokumentów i formularzy wewnątrz systemu oraz wprowadzenie rozwiązania mapującego podróż użytkownika.

Poprawa funkcji raportowania

W celu usprawnienia raportowania zaproponowaliśmy przeniesienie tej funkcji do Power BI – usługa ta umożliwia dynamiczne generowanie raportów i podsumowań dla użytkowników.

Nasza współpraca w liczbach

4

dni warsztatów

~30

zaangażowanych stron

5

opisanych kluczowych procesów

~400

opracowanych user stories

20

zidentyfikowanych raportów

3

przeprowadzone audyty technologiczne

Główne korzyści naszej współpracy

  • Dogłębne zrozumienie problemu: Dzięki szczegółowej analizie ograniczeń istniejącego systemu i perspektyw użytkowników daliśmy klientowi podstawy do podejmowania świadomych decyzji opartych na solidnych danych.

  • Kompleksowe podejście do rozwoju: Utworzyliśmy dokładny plan ulepszenia systemu i zintegrowania go z najnowocześniejszymi technologiami, dzięki czemu stał się bardziej przyjazny dla użytkownika, stabilny i skalowalny.

  • Jasny kosztorys i harmonogram: Oszacowaliśmy możliwe koszty i czas realizacji projektu – informacje te były kluczowe dla klienta i jego dalszych decyzji.

  • Opłacalne rozwiązania: Określiliśmy możliwości wykorzystania rozwiązań low-code i no-code, które są mniej kosztowne, a jednocześnie skuteczne, tworząc przy tym etapową strategię aktualizacji systemu uwzględniającą ograniczenia budżetowe.

  • Rekomendacje oparte na audycie technologicznym: Przeprowadziliśmy dogłębną ocenę architektury i bezpieczeństwa systemu oraz procesu zarządzania danymi, a na tej podstawie opracowaliśmy praktyczne zalecenia dotyczące zwiększenia bezpieczeństwa, zgodności i użyteczności systemu, co polepszyło jego stabilność i wydajność.